#1
Strange Things Happening On The Sun
A lot of really
weird things have been happening on the sun lately. For example,
recently there was a tornado on the sun that was five
times larger than the earth. The following is how this solar
tornado was described by a
recent Wired article....
Over
the course of three hours, this behemoth reached up from the sun’s
surface to a height of 125,000 miles, or roughly half the distance
between the Earth and the moon. The hot gases were whipped up
to nearly 186,000 miles per hour. In comparison, the wind speed
of terrestrial tornadoes generally reaches a paltry 100 miles
per hour.

So just how
serious is the threat posed by the spent fuel pool at reactor number
4?
Well, just
check out the
following assessment from a Japanese news source....
One of
the biggest issues that we face is the possibility that the spent
nuclear fuel pool of the No. 4 reactor at the stricken Fukushima
No. 1 Nuclear Power Plant will collapse.
The storage
pool in the No. 4 reactor building has a total of 1,535 fuel rods,
or 460 tons of nuclear fuel, in it and the storage pools are barely
intact on the building’s third and fourth floors. If the storage
pool breaks and runs dry, the nuclear fuel inside will overheat
and explode, causing a massive amount of radioactive substances
to spread over a wide area.
The worse-case
scenario drawn up by the government includes not only the collapse
of the No. 4 reactor pool, but the disintegration of spent fuel
rods from all the plant’s other reactors. If this were to happen,
residents in the Tokyo metropolitan area would be forced to evacuate.
#3
Mount Fuji In Japan About To Erupt?
Mount Fuji
in Japan had been dormant for about 300 years, but in recent months
there have been a lot of signs that the volcano is waking up. If
Mount Fuji were to experience a full-blown major eruption, millions
of Japanese could potentially die and the Japanese economy would
immediately collapse.
The following
is from an article that was recently posted on The
Extinction Protocol....
Reports
are appearing about unrest and signs of a possible awakening of
Mt Fuji volcano in Japan. According to a report which includes
an unclear photo of the area, a row of new craters, the largest
50 m in diameter, has appeared on the eastern flank of the volcano
at 2200 m elevation. Steam was observed erupting from these vents.
The observation joins other signs suggesting a gradual reawakening:
A swarm of earthquakes including 4 of magnitude 5 have occurred
northeast of Mt Fuji on and after 28 January. An earlier 6.4M
quake occurred under the volcano on 15 March 2011. The report
also mentions increased activity from a fumarole vent at 1500
m elevation and hot spring areas at the eastern flank observed
since 2003. These locations seem to be aligned geographically,
and are probably connected. Dr. Masaaki Kimura of Ryukyu University
is quoted to admit that there is an increased risk of an eruption
on the eastern flank and that the status of the volcano should
be closely monitored.
